The reason I'm annoyed at this benching is because "going with the hot hand" is a short term strategy. The message we are sending these players by benching them is that we don't believe in their future development and only see them as a stopgap as opposed to young stars like Harden/Westbrook who were almost never benched in a similar fashion despite obvious flaws in their game early on. Right now, the Rockets seem content with running a basketball version of "running back by committee" with Lin and Bev. This stunts the growth of both Lin and Bev. Both of these players are very young, and not letting them play through crap games is limiting their in-game confidence and situational awareness. Although you can win games in the short-run with this "hot hand" strategy, our window for winning a championship is not nearly as short as people will have you believe. If we were the Nets, then you maximize whatever chances you have this year; with one of the youngest teams, you need to still develop your borderline star players ala the Spurs. Imagine if young Tony Parker was benched for half the game when he proved ineffective. Personally, I believe that Lin has miles more potential and should be given the green light to develop. Regardless, we need to CHOOSE one of these two guards and let them play through their mistakes. This is getting silly.
